Output 3c31bd528f4919812da30b4414b1075ddc631d877489208fdaa2b51e58922e29:29

value
13970056
script pubkey
OP_0 OP_PUSHBYTES_20 b2addaf4acad410b4fb23c9e4235fae584765439
address
bc1qk2ka4a9v44qsknaj8j0yyd06ukz8v4pe7vz08t
transaction
3c31bd528f4919812da30b4414b1075ddc631d877489208fdaa2b51e58922e29
spent
true